WWE is set to hold it’s first-ever ‘King & Queen of the Ring’ event in May.

It was reported by Wrestlenomics that WWE’s King & Queen of the Ring event is set for May 27, which would likely be the same weekend as AEW’s Double or Nothing event.

In an update from PWInsider, the event is set to take place on May 27, and will be the latest WWE premium live event to take place in Saudi Arabia.

An updated report from PWInsider notes that the event is set to take place in Jeddah, Saudi Arabia.

The previous WWE Saudi Arabia event took place in November, when WWE held Crown Jewel in Riyadh.

The event saw Roman Reigns defeat Logan Paul in the main event to retain the Undisputed WWE Universal Championship in Logan’s second ever singles match.

This won’t be the first time a King and Queen will be crowned in Saudi Arabia, as WWE held the finals of the 2021 King of the Ring and Queen’s Crown Tournaments in the country in 2021.

The tournaments were won by Xavier Woods and Zelina Vega respectively.
